River Plate has been a cornerstone of Argentinian football since its foundation in 1901. The club, based in Buenos Aires, boasts a storied history filled with remarkable players and memorable achievements. Throughout its existence, River Plate has nurtured talents such as Alfredo Di Stéfano, Enrique Omar Sívori, and more recently, players like Marcelo Gallardo. Under the guidance of various managers, River Plate has consistently challenged for domestic and international glory, solidifying its status as a prominent footballing institution.
During the 1990s and early 2000s, River Plate showcased a golden generation of players, claiming numerous Argentine titles and making significant strides in the Copa Libertadores. The club’s affection for attacking football and its commitment to developing youth talent created a legacy that is celebrated by fans and historians alike.

The retro shirt of River Plate showcases a classic design characterised by its white base and a distinctive red diagonal sash. This simple yet striking feature is synonymous with the club and has become a hallmark of their identity. The shirt is typically complemented by black shorts, creating a timeless aesthetic that resonates with football aficionados.
Moreover, the materials used in retro shirts differ significantly from modern-day kits. The fabric is often heavier and features a more traditional cut, reflecting the fashion of football in previous decades. The incorporation of vintage sponsor logos and embroidery adds to its appeal, creating an authentic representation of River Plate’s rich history.
